cressws1 Posted September 3, 2010 Share Posted September 3, 2010 If its a MK1 like mine I did this: - Remove the Drivers side wheel - Remove the Wheel arch lining (3 or 4 screws, Really easy) - This reveals one bolt on the underside of the headlight unit, Remove this. - Remove the two bolts on the top of the headlight unit. NOTE: You might have to remove a plastic cover above the front grill to access one of the top bolts on the headlight unit, But this again is just 2/3 plastic lugs.
